Wied Binġemma (l/o Nadur)

This rather large woodland area is populated with a number of old almond trees (lewż) and possibly the oldest specimens of the olive tree (żebbuġ) in Gozo.
This area had been declared a Nature Reserve in 2001.
Mepa declared this site as a Tree Protected Area on May 24, 2011, in accordance with the provisions of the Trees and Woodlands Protection Regulations (2011) as per Government Notice No. 473/11.
